Descripción
Sumario:The results of the spectral classification of about 1800 A type stars brighter than 6.5 mag and north of -20° are reported. Photometric data for these objects were taken from the photometric catalogue existing at the Observatory. As an interesting by-product the discovery of ninety stars with spectral peculiarities is reported. The color-color diagram for dwarfs and giants are briefly discussed and also the relation of color-spectral type. The paper in full will be published elsewhere.
